The substituents (ethyl and nitro) are cited in alphabetical order with numbers assigned in the direction that gives the lowest number at the first point of difference. (b) An isomer of the compound in part (a) is 4-ethyl-3-nitrophenol. (c) The parent compound is phenol. It bears, in alphabetical order, a benzyl group at C-4 and a chlorine at C-2. (d) This compound is named as a derivative of anisole, C6H5OCH3. Because multiplicative pre- fixes (di, tri-, etc.) are not considered when alphabetizing substituents, isopropyl precedes dimethyl. (e) The compound is an aryl ester of trichloroacetic acid.
